
body { background-color:#000; }
.header { height:225px !important;}
.image_div { width:1000px; margin:-320px auto 0; text-align:center; overflow:hidden; border:1px solid #FFF; }
.real_estate { width:980px; height:50px; }
.center_point { width:980px; height:96px; background:url(../images/port_border.png) top left repeat-x; margin:-46px auto 0; position:relative; }
.contact_div1 { clear:both; background-color:#FFF; border:1px solid #FFF; min-width:1024px; }

.inner_div { width:1000px; margin:0 auto; padding-bottom:0; }
.inner_div p { text-align:left; font-family:Arial, Helvetica, sans-serif; font-size:25px; color:#2c5aa9; font-weight:bold; }
.manu_area { width:100%; height:70px; background:url(../images/port_bg.jpg) top left repeat; margin-top:-1px; }

.inner_manu { width:980px; overflow:hidden; margin:0 auto; position:relative !important; z-index:9999999 !important; }
.inner_manu ul {  list-style:none; display:block; }
.inner_manu ul li { float:left; padding:18px 0px 33px 0px; display:inline-block; background:url(../images/port_line.jpg) right 1px no-repeat; width:163px; text-align:center;  }
.inner_manu ul li a { color:#2c5aa9; font-family: 'Swis721GreekLtBTLight'; font-size:15px; font-weight:bold; text-decoration:none; }
.inner_manu ul li a span { color:#666; font-family: 'Swis721GreekLtBTLight'; font-size:15px; font-weight:bold; text-decoration:none; }
.inner_manu ul li.current { background:url(../images/hello.jpg) top left no-repeat;  }
.inner_manu ul li:hover { background:url(../images/hello.jpg) top left no-repeat;  }
.inner_manu ul li.first {  background-color:#2c5aa9 !important; height:5px; background-image:none !important;}
.inner_manu ul .first a { color:#fff !important; }
.inner_manu ul .first a:hover { color:#fff !important; }
.inner_manu ul li.first:hover { background-image:none !important;}
.inner_manu ul li.first .side_image { position:absolute; left:163px; top:20px; }

.port_div111 { width:1000px; overflow:hidden; margin:20px auto 0; position:relative; z-index:99999; }
.maun_text { width:800px; font-family:Arial, Helvetica, sans-serif; font-size:25px; font-weight:bold; color:#2c5aa9; margin:5px 0 30px; float:left; }
.image_test { float:right; }

.inner_image { width:1000px; margin:0 auto 50px; background-color:#c4cbd3; }
.inner_image .clientimage {}
.inner_image .clientimage img{ width:1000px;  /*height:287px;*/ border:none;}

.button_div{ width:960px; margin:0 auto; overflow:hidden; }
.text_div { width:400px; float:left; padding:20px 0; }
.text_div p { font-family:Arial, Helvetica, sans-serif; font-size:20px; color:#fff; font-weight:bold; }

.button { float:right; }
.button img { margin:18px 0 0 8px; }
